Make a difference as Nursing Assistant As a Nursing Assistant, you will play a vital role in delivering compassionate and essential care to patients recovering from surgery. Your responsibilities will include providing basic nursing care while strictly adhering to safety protocols and standards. You'll assist nurses with intake procedures, accurately obtaining and documenting vital signs and patient weight, contributing to a seamless recovery process. In addition, you will be responsible for stocking the Extended Recovery Unit with necessary equipment and supplies, ensuring a well-prepared environment for patient care. Transporting patients safely and maintaining a clean, organized workspace will be integral to your role, emphasizing our commitment to excellence and safety.
